Desorganização na Inteligência Artificial: 7 Métodos Infalíveis para Otimizar o Fluxo de Trabalho

A IA promete eficiência, mas a desorganização pode sabotar seus benefícios. Descubra 7 métodos práticos para estruturar seus projetos de IA, otimizar o fluxo de trabalho e maximizar os resultados, mesmo em equipes remotas.

Desorganização na Inteligência Artificial: 7 Métodos Infalíveis para Otimizar o Fluxo de Trabalho
AMBIENTE: Escritório moderno e bem iluminado, com grandes janelas e vista para uma cidade. ILUMINAÇÃO: Luz natural suave entrando pelas janelas, complementada por luzes de teto modernas. DETALHE DA CENA: Uma mesa de trabalho organizada com um laptop aberto exibindo um diagrama de fluxo de trabalho de IA, um quadro branco com anotações e diagramas, e uma xícara de café. SITUAÇÃO: Uma pessoa (mulher, 30 anos, vestindo roupas casuais de trabalho) está sentada à mesa, olhando para o diagrama de flux - (Imagem Gerada com AI)
Desorganização na Inteligência Artificial: 7 Métodos Infalíveis

Desorganização na Inteligência Artificial: 7 Métodos Infalíveis para Otimizar o Fluxo de Trabalho

A Inteligência Artificial (IA) transformou radicalmente a forma como trabalhamos, oferecendo oportunidades sem precedentes para automação, análise de dados e tomada de decisões mais inteligentes. No entanto, a implementação e o gerenciamento de projetos de IA podem ser complexos e, se não forem devidamente estruturados, podem levar à desorganização, atrasos, custos excessivos e, em última análise, ao fracasso do projeto. Em um cenário de trabalho remoto cada vez mais comum, a desorganização em projetos de IA pode ser ainda mais prejudicial, dificultando a comunicação, a colaboração e o acompanhamento do progresso.

Por Que a Desorganização é um Problema em Projetos de IA?

A IA não é apenas sobre algoritmos e modelos; é sobre pessoas, dados, infraestrutura e processos. A desorganização pode se manifestar de diversas formas, impactando negativamente cada um desses aspectos:

  • Dados Desorganizados: Dados sujos, incompletos ou mal rotulados podem comprometer a precisão e a confiabilidade dos modelos de IA.
  • Fluxo de Trabalho Confuso: Falta de clareza nas responsabilidades, processos mal definidos e comunicação ineficiente podem levar a erros, retrabalho e atrasos.
  • Versionamento Inadequado: A falta de controle de versão de modelos, dados e código pode dificultar a reprodução de resultados e a identificação de problemas.
  • Colaboração Ineficiente: Em equipes remotas, a falta de ferramentas e processos adequados para a colaboração pode levar a silos de informação e dificuldades na coordenação do trabalho.
  • Falta de Documentação: A ausência de documentação clara e concisa sobre o projeto, os modelos e os dados dificulta a manutenção, a depuração e a transferência de conhecimento.

7 Métodos Infalíveis para Combater a Desorganização em Projetos de IA

1. Defina um Escopo Claro e Objetivos Mensuráveis

Antes de iniciar qualquer projeto de IA, é crucial definir um escopo claro e objetivos mensuráveis. O que você espera alcançar com a IA? Quais são os indicadores-chave de desempenho (KPIs) que você usará para medir o sucesso? Um escopo bem definido ajuda a evitar o desvio do projeto e a manter o foco nos resultados desejados. Utilize a metodologia SMART (Specific, Measurable, Achievable, Relevant, Time-bound) para garantir que seus objetivos sejam claros e alcançáveis.

2. Implemente um Sistema de Gerenciamento de Dados Robusto

A qualidade dos dados é fundamental para o sucesso de qualquer projeto de IA. Implemente um sistema de gerenciamento de dados robusto que inclua:

  • Coleta de Dados: Defina fontes de dados confiáveis e processos de coleta automatizados.
  • Limpeza de Dados: Utilize técnicas de limpeza de dados para remover erros, valores ausentes e outliers.
  • Rotulagem de Dados: Garanta que os dados sejam rotulados de forma consistente e precisa.
  • Armazenamento de Dados: Utilize um sistema de armazenamento seguro e escalável, como um data lake ou um data warehouse.
  • Governança de Dados: Estabeleça políticas e procedimentos para garantir a qualidade, a segurança e a conformidade dos dados.

3. Adote um Fluxo de Trabalho Ágil

Metodologias ágeis, como Scrum e Kanban, são ideais para projetos de IA, pois permitem iterações rápidas, feedback contínuo e adaptação às mudanças. Divida o projeto em sprints curtos, defina tarefas claras e atribua responsabilidades específicas a cada membro da equipe. Utilize ferramentas de gerenciamento de projetos, como Jira ou Trello, para acompanhar o progresso e identificar gargalos.

4. Utilize um Sistema de Controle de Versão

O controle de versão é essencial para gerenciar as diferentes versões de modelos, dados e código. Utilize um sistema de controle de versão, como Git, para rastrear as alterações, colaborar com outros membros da equipe e reverter para versões anteriores, se necessário. Plataformas como GitHub, GitLab e Bitbucket facilitam o versionamento e a colaboração em projetos de IA.

5. Invista em Ferramentas de Colaboração

Em equipes remotas, a colaboração é fundamental. Invista em ferramentas de colaboração que facilitem a comunicação, o compartilhamento de informações e o trabalho em equipe. Algumas opções incluem:

  • Comunicação: Slack, Microsoft Teams
  • Videoconferência: Zoom, Google Meet
  • Compartilhamento de Arquivos: Google Drive, Dropbox
  • Gerenciamento de Projetos: Jira, Trello
  • Documentação Colaborativa: Google Docs, Notion

6. Documente Tudo!

A documentação é a chave para a manutenção, a depuração e a transferência de conhecimento. Documente todos os aspectos do projeto, incluindo:

  • Objetivos do Projeto: Descreva o que você espera alcançar com a IA.
  • Arquitetura do Modelo: Explique a estrutura e o funcionamento do modelo de IA.
  • Dados Utilizados: Detalhe as fontes de dados, o processo de limpeza e a rotulagem.
  • Código: Comente o código de forma clara e concisa.
  • Resultados: Documente os resultados obtidos e as métricas de desempenho.

7. Automatize o Máximo Possível

A automação pode ajudar a reduzir a desorganização e a aumentar a eficiência. Automatize tarefas repetitivas, como a coleta de dados, a limpeza de dados, o treinamento de modelos e a implantação de modelos. Utilize ferramentas de automação de machine learning (AutoML) para acelerar o desenvolvimento de modelos e reduzir a necessidade de intervenção manual.

Conclusão

A desorganização em projetos de IA pode ser um obstáculo significativo para o sucesso. Ao implementar os 7 métodos infalíveis descritos neste artigo, você pode estruturar seus projetos, otimizar o fluxo de trabalho e maximizar os resultados. Lembre-se que a organização é um processo contínuo que requer disciplina, comunicação e colaboração. Ao investir em organização, você estará investindo no sucesso de seus projetos de IA e no futuro de sua equipe.